Marvell, AR and Reyno, AR have a very similar cost of living, with only a 0.4% difference in their overall index. Marvell scores 57 while Reyno scores 57 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.

On the housing front, median rent in Marvell is $691/month compared to $656/month in Reyno — a 5%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Reyno has cheaper rent, Marvell actually has lower median home values ($59,100 vs $75,000).

Median household income in Marvell is $49,000 compared to $54,208 in Reyno (-9.6%). While Reyno is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Marvell spend roughly 16.9% of their income on rent, more than the 14.5% in Reyno.
